Output e6e59636f481afda072655fa572e8564f596898ea3a0bf49197588116f1c022e:0

value
698
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de4b4dc3ee1576bb865539cac160381098b5d77cadee3214a4aa5e6e7bda3e31
address
bc1pme95mslwz4mthpj4889vzcpczzvtt4mu4hhry99y4f0xu7768ccsdyr2aa
transaction
e6e59636f481afda072655fa572e8564f596898ea3a0bf49197588116f1c022e
confirmations
9721
spent
true